Chain & Smart Contract Auditor (Rust)-تدقيق مجاني للعقود الذكية بلغة رست

ارفع مستوى أمن سلسلة الكتل باستخدام التدقيق المدعوم بالذكاء الاصطناعي

Home > GPTs > Chain & Smart Contract Auditor (Rust)
قيّم هذه الأداة

20.0 / 5 (200 votes)

Chain & Smart Contract Auditor (Rust)

Chain & Smart Contract Auditor (Rust) هو أداة متخصصة مصممة لتعزيز أمن وموثوقية تطبيقات سلسلة الكتل، وخاصة تلك المطورة باستخدام Rust، مثل بيئات Substrate و NEAR و Solana و Casper. يستخدم المدقق تقنيات تحليل متقدمة لمراجعة وتدقيق العقود الذكية وبروتوكولات سلسلة الكتل للعثور على أوجه الضعف المحتملة وأخطاء الترميز والمخاطر الأمنية. من خلال محاكاة الهجمات وفحص الشفرة للعثور على الفخاخ الشائعة، وضمان الالتزام بأفضل ممارسات الترميز، يهدف إلى استباق انتهاكات الأمن وتحسين أداء العقد. على سبيل المثال، يمكن للأداة تحليل عقد ذكي DeFi على سلسلة الكتل Solana لتحديد أوجه الضعف مثل هجمات إعادة الإدخال أو عيوب المنطق التي يمكن أن تؤدي إلى الوصول غير المصرح به أو فقدان الأموال. Powered by ChatGPT-4o

الوظائف الرئيسية لـ Chain & Smart Contract Auditor (Rust)

  • اكتشاف أوجه الضعف

    Example Example

    تحديد ثغرات إعادة الإدخال في عقد ذكي لمنصة إقراض DeFi.

    Example Scenario

    في سيناريو حيث تسمح منصة DeFi بأخذ قروض مقابل ضمانات، يتحقق المدقق من تسلسل المكالمات التي يمكن أن تسمح للمقترضين بسحب المزيد من الأموال من قيمة ضماناتهم بسبب ثغرة إعادة إدخال.

  • اقتراحات تحسين الشفرة

    Example Example

    تحسين استخدام الغاز في سوق NFT قائم على Substrate.

    Example Scenario

    يحلل المدقق عملية سك العملات غير القابلة للاستبدال لتوصية بتحسينات تقلل التكلفة الحوسبية وتحسن سرعة المعاملات، مما يعزز تجربة المستخدم والقدرة على التوسع.

  • فرض أفضل ممارسات الأمان

    Example Example

    ضمان توليد أرقام عشوائية آمن في ألعاب سلسلة الكتل.

    Example Scenario

    بالنسبة للعبة سلسلة كتل تمنح رموزًا غير قابلة للاستبدال عشوائية، يراجع المدقق آلية توليد الأرقام العشوائية للتأكد من أنها غير قابلة للتنبؤ ومقاومة للتلاعب، مما يحمي عدالة اللعبة.

  • مراجعة الشفرة الآلية واليدوية

    Example Example

    مراجعة شفرة العقد الذكي لمنصة تداول لامركزية (DEX) على بروتوكول NEAR.

    Example Scenario

    يستخدم المدقق الأدوات الآلية والفحص اليدوي لمراجعة العقد الذكي لـ DEX، وتحديد المشكلات مثل خوارزميات تجميع السيولة غير الفعالة أو المكالمات الخارجية غير الآمنة التي يمكن للمهاجمين استغلالها.

المستخدمين المثاليين لـ Chain & Smart Contract Auditor (Rust)

  • مطورو سلسلة الكتل

    يستفيد مطورو تطبيقات اللامركزية (dApps) على سلاسل الكتل القائمة على رست من التحليل المفصل للشفرات وتقييمات الأمن، مما يضمن أمن تطبيقاتهم وكفاءتها قبل النشر.

  • الشركات الناشئة في مجال سلسلة الكتل

    تتطلب الشركات الناشئة في مجال سلسلة الكتل عمليات تدقيق أمني صارمة لتأمين منصاتها وبناء الثقة مع المستخدمين. يوفر Chain & Smart Contract Auditor مراجعة شاملة لازمة لتحديد المخاطر الأمنية والتخفيف منها.

  • فرق سلسلة الكتل في المؤسسات

    تحتاج المؤسسات التي تستخدم سلسلة الكتل للعمليات التجارية أو لتقديم خدمات جديدة إلى التأكد من أن عقودها وبروتوكولاتها خالية من الثغرات. يوفر المدقق العمق التحليلي المطلوب لتلبية معايير الأمن الصارمة للشركات.

  • مشاريع DeFi

    مشاريع DeFi، مع معاملاتها وآلياتها المالية المعقدة، معرضة لخطر الهجمات بشكل كبير. تستفيد من خدمات التدقيق المتخصصة التي تفهم تعقيدات عقود DeFi ويمكنها توفير حلول أمنية مستهدفة.

استخدام Chain & Smart Contract Auditor (Rust)

  • 1

    قم بزيارة yeschat.ai للحصول على تجربة مجانية بدون تسجيل الدخول، كما لا تحتاج إلى خدمة ChatGPT Plus.

  • 2

    حدد خيار 'Chain & Smart Contract Auditor (Rust)' من قائمة الأدوات المتاحة لبدء الخدمة.

  • 3

    قم بتحميل أو لصق شفرة سلسلة الكتل أو العقد الذكي الخاصة بك المكتوبة بلغة Rust للتدقيق.

  • 4

    استخدم ميزات الأداة لتحليل شفرتك للعثور على ثغرات أمنية محتملة أو عدم كفاءات أو أفضل ممارسات ترميز.

  • 5

    راجع نتائج التدقيق المقدمة، بما في ذلك أي مخاطر محددة أو اقتراحات للتحسين ورؤى حول أمان العقد الذكي.

Chain & Smart Contract Auditor (Rust) الأسئلة والأجوبة

  • أي سلاسل كتل يدعمها Chain & Smart Contract Auditor (Rust)؟

    يدعم الأداة بشكل أساسي منصات سلسلة كتل قائمة على Rust بما في ذلك بيئات Substrate و Casper و NEAR.

  • هل يمكن لهذه الأداة توفير مشاركة الثغرات في الوقت الفعلي؟

    نعم، يوفر مشاركة الثغرات في الوقت الفعلي مما يمكّن المستخدمين من تتبع نتائج التدقيق أثناء تحديدها.

  • كيف تتعامل هذه الأداة مع التحليل التشفيري؟

    يؤدي تحليلًا شاملًا للممارسات التشفيرية لتحديد توليد الأرقام العشوائية الضعيف أو المتحيز وغيرها من أوجه الضعف التشفيرية.

  • هل المدقق قادر على تحليل المنطق التجاري والأخطاء المنطقية؟

    بالتأكيد. يقيّم المنطق التجاري والأخطاء المنطقية، مما يضمن التزام العقد الذكي بقواعد العمل والمتطلبات الوظيفية المحددة.

  • هل يمكن لهذه الأداة المساعدة في تحديد أخطاء الأذونات في العقود الذكية؟

    نعم، يمكنه تحديد أخطاء الأذونات، مما يضمن عدم تنفيذ الوظائف المقتصرة على أدوار معينة من قبل مستخدمين غير مصرّح لهم.